Sex differences favoring women have been found in a number of studies of episodic memory. This study examined sex differences in verbal, nonverbal, and visuospatial episodic memory tasks. Results showed that although women performed at a higher level on a composite verbal and nonverbal episodic memory score, men performed at a higher level on a composite score of episodic memory tasks requiring visuospatial processing. Thus, men can use their superior visuospatial abilities to excel in highly visuospatial episodic memory tasks, whereas women seem to excel in episodic memory tasks in which a verbalization of the material is possible. Introduction
The surprise question (SQ) “Would I be surprised if this patient died within the next xx months” can be used by different professions to foresee the need of serious illness conversations in patients approaching end of life. However, little is known about the different perspectives of nurses and physicians in responses to the SQ and factors influencing their appraisals. The aim was to explore nurses' and physicians' responses to the SQ regarding patients on hemodialysis, and to investigate how these answers were associated with patient clinical characteristics.Methods
This comparative cross-sectional study included 361 patients for whom 112 nurses and 15 physicians responded to the SQ regarding 6 and 12 months. Patient characteristics, performance status, and comorbidities were obtained. Cohen's kappa was used to analyze the interrater agreement between nurses and physicians in their responses to the SQ and multivariable logistic regression was applied to reveal the independent association to patient clinical characteristics.Findings
Proportions of nurses and physicians responding to the SQ with “no, not surprised” was similar regarding 6 and 12 months. However, there was a substantial difference concerning which specific patient the nurses and physicians responded “no, not surprised”, within 6 (κ = 0.366, p < 0.001, 95% CI = 0.288–0.474) and 12 months (κ = 0.379, p < 0.001, 95% CI = 0.281–0.477). There were also differences in the patient clinical characteristics associated with nurses' and physicians' responses to the SQ.Discussion
Nurses and physicians have different perspectives in their appraisal when responding to the SQ for patients on hemodialysis. Optotracers are conformation-sensitive fluorescent tracer molecules that detect peptide- and carbohydrate-based biopolymers. Their binding to bacterial cell walls allows selective detection and visualisation of Staphylococcus aureus (S. aureus). Here, we investigated the structural properties providing optimal detection of S. aureus. We quantified spectral shifts and fluorescence intensity in mixes of bacteria and optotracers, using automatic peak analysis, cross-correlation, and area-under-curve analysis. We found that the length of the conjugated backbone and the number of charged groups, but not their distribution, are important factors for selective detection of S. aureus. The photophysical properties of optotracers were greatly improved by incorporating a donor-acceptor-donor (D-A-D)-type motif in the conjugated backbone. With significantly reduced background and binding-induced on-switch of fluorescence, these optotracers enabled real-time recordings of S. aureus growth. Collectively, this demonstrates that chemical structure and photophysics are key tunable characteristics in the development of optotracers for selective detection of bacterial species. 相似文献
